Lorain County Joint Vocational School is a public vocational school in Oberlin, Ohio. LCJVS primarily serves 13 school districts located in Lorain County, with parts of Erie and Huron counties also covered.
William R Burton serves 1,222 students in grades 8-12. 
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 14% (which is lower than the Ohio state average of 54%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is lower than the Ohio state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 25%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Ohio state average of 34% (majority Black).

William R Burton's student population of 1,222 students has declined by 19% over five school years.
The teacher population of 90 teachers has grown by 15% over five school years.
